What affects the price

The final price for impact windows depends on several variables. The biggest factor is the size and type of your window frames, along with the specific glass thickness required for your local building codes. Opting for custom shapes or specialized tints also shifts the total. Installation complexity matters too; if your existing frames are damaged or if the project requires extra structural support, labor costs will increase.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

Summer heat puts a massive strain on air conditioning systems. Impact windows help manage indoor temperatures by blocking out intense solar heat, which means your cooling system does not have to work nearly as hard. This efficiency is a huge benefit during the hottest months, helping you maintain a cool home without excessive energy waste.
